This really helps in complying with strict-casts. YamlNode.value returns a `dynamic`, which is then often passed somewhere which accepts Object (and then does some type tests). To avoid the implicit cast from `dynamic`, we can use `.valueOrThrow` (or basically just `.value as Object`).
